SHELDON, Iowa (KCAU) — The Prairie Museum is home to the Sheldon Historical Society Hall of Fame. There are 35 members, from business, industry, military, sports, and other areas. The Hall of Famers have distinguished themselves on a national basis in their career field. Sheldon is home to three Olympians. The first is Morningside graduate A.G. Kruger who competed in the hammer throw in three summer Olympic games: 2004 in Athens, Greece; 2008 in Beijing, China; and 2012 in London, England. There were also the Brands twins, Tom and Terry, two Olympian wrestlers. Tom Brands won gold in 1996 in Atlanta, and Terry earned a bronze medal in 2000 in Sydney. Even with the three Olympians being internationally recognized, the Hall of Fame honorees are all natives of the Sheldon community. 'Certainly, Brian Duffy who is managing partner of the largest law firm in the world and he graduated form Sheldon High School. He's excelled in the legal profession. It's really quite amazing,' said local historian Tom Whorley. Duffy, a 1983 Sheldon High School graduate, is the chief executive officer (CEO) for Greenberg Traurig, a multinational law firm with more than 2,500 attorneys in 43 offices around the world.
